Shanta Gold
Sector: Basic Materials / Metals and Mining
Market Cap: £77m, Stock Rank: 90
Risk/Size/Style: Speculative, Small Cap, Style Neutral
Speculative, small-cap mining companies come with high risks but their potential lottery-like payoffs often attract investors. Shanta Gold is slightly unusual in that it’s a small gold producer with a track record of revenues and profitability. Its Tanzanian-based assets include New Luika Gold Mine, Singida, Songea and Lupa Goldfield exploration.
Shares in Shanta put in a very solid performance in 2019, as the price of gold rose through the year. Indeed, part of its appeal is its lack of reliance on UK economic or consumer sentiment. All the same, small-cap mining companies are highly sensitive and often get priced accordingly. Shanta’s single-figure P/E speaks to the market’s wariness of these kinds of shares.
In a Q3 update in October, Eric Zurrin, Shanta’s Chief Executive, said: "As we rapidly pay down our debt and improve our financial position, New Luika Gold Mine continues to perform operationally. This quarter has seen us produce over 22,000 oz of gold and positions the Company on track to again meet our guidance for the year. Net debt at US$20.7 m is now the lowest it has been in over six years and has decreased by over 50% since the same period two years ago.”
